FWD’s Leaders Co-create First NFT Collection

The collection marks the beginning of FWD’s venture into the metaverse, highlighting the insurer’s commitment to enhance customer experiences

HONG KONG SAR - Media OutReach - 13 June 2022 - FWD Insurance (“FWD”) announced today their latest development into the innovative and evolving world of non-fungible tokens (“NFTs”). FWD’s leadership team co-created its first robot-themed NFT collection1 during the 2022 Step Change leadership conference, which brought together the company’s management to explore leadership qualities and inspire innovative thinking.

This NFT collection marks a major milestone as the brand’s first ever activation within the metaverse space. By firstly engaging internal teams on this NFT initiative, FWD aims to further enhance customer experiences with a diverse suite of engagement activities extended to the metaverse so that people can pursue their passions and live life to the fullest at anywhere, anytime.

The NFT collection created and designed by FWD’s leadership team consists of nine different customised robot artworks designed by FWD’s employees. Each robot demonstrates various leadership attributes.

About FWD Hong Kong & Macau

FWD Hong Kong & Macau are part of the FWD Group, a pan-Asian life insurance business with approximately 10 million customers across 10 markets, including some of the fastest growing insurance markets in the world.

FWD Hong Kong has been assigned strong financial ratings by international agencies. It offers life and medical insurance, employee benefits, and financial planning. FWD Macau provides a suite of life and medical insurance.

FWD is focused on making the insurance journey simpler, faster and smoother, with innovative propositions and easy-to-understand products, supported by digital technology. Through this customer-led approach, FWD is committed to changing the way people feel about insurance.
